3 ways 100% Pure Stroke will perfect your putting stroke


1. ARC Almost every Touring Pro uses a pendulum putting stroke. A pendulum putting stroke requires your shoulders, arms, hands and putter all to move as one unit. Train to initiate this movement with your shoulders. This will result in a bob and weave motion of your shoulders, and along with the angle of your spine will create arc in your putting stroke. Never initiate a putting stroke with your wrists or hands, as this could result in off arc strokes, thus the putter face may be open or closed at impact. Arc is a slight inside path on the backstroke as the face opens slightly, then a smooth acceleration to square at impact, followed by a slight inside path on follow through as the face closes slightly. 100% Pure Stroke will detect if your on arc, by deflecting putts where your putter face was open or closed at impact.

2. ACCELERATION Generally speaking deceleration occurs when you take the putter back further then necessary to achieve a desired distance. When you take it back to far and feel that you can't accelerate you'll make adjustments before or at impact. Years ago Ben Hogan had a similar problem so bad that either Ben or his friends called it "The Yips." It's a good idea to take a few practice strokes that image the distance of your backstroke before you take the putt. 100% Pure Stroke will detect decelerated strokes, but it's uncertain whether the stroke will result in a push or a pull. You'll get to know the difference between being off arc and decelerating. 100% Pure Stroke will train you to accelerate by training you not to decelerate. Deceleration is the causal factor of "The Yips."
